โ€ข Introduction to Food Logistics Forecasting – Understanding the basics and importance of food logistics forecasting in the global context.
โ€ข Data Analysis for Food Logistics – Collecting, cleaning, and interpreting data relevant to food logistics forecasting.
โ€ข Demand Planning in Global Food Logistics – Analyzing historical demand and planning future demand for efficient food logistics operations.
โ€ข Inventory Management for Food Logistics – Managing inventory levels to optimize food logistics and reduce wastage.
โ€ข Global Food Supply Chain Management – Examining the global food supply chain and its impact on forecasting.
โ€ข Forecasting Models in Food Logistics – Studying various forecasting models and techniques to apply in food logistics operations.
โ€ข Technology in Food Logistics Forecasting – Utilizing advanced technologies like AI, ML, and IoT for efficient forecasting.
โ€ข Risk Management in Global Food Logistics Forecasting – Identifying and mitigating risks associated with food logistics forecasting.
โ€ข Sustainability in Food Logistics Forecasting – Incorporating sustainability principles in global food logistics forecasting practices.

Logistics Managers play a crucial role in planning, implementing, and controlling the efficient flow of goods, information, and other resources, from point of origin to point of consumption. With a 35% share, they take up the largest segment of the pie chart. Supply Chain Analysts, with a 25% share, are responsible for evaluating the performance of supply chain operations and identifying areas for improvement. Their role in the industry is becoming increasingly important due to the complexities of food logistics. Procurement Specialists, accounting for 20% of the chart, focus on sourcing and acquiring goods, services, or works from external suppliers, ensuring they meet the organization's needs and quality standards. Food Safety Coordinators and Quality Assurance Auditors hold the remaining 15% and 5% shares, respectively. Food Safety Coordinators manage the organization's food safety policies, while Quality Assurance Auditors inspect products, processes, or services to ensure they meet specified requirements.
